David Conn (@david_conn) 's Twitter Profile Photo

Bury FC: That deal which enabled £1 buyer Steve Dale to get the CVA passed: Company which bought a purported £7m debt for £70k (then wanted £1.75m for it) is owned by his daughter's partner. theguardian.com/football/2019/…
